Protecting your home involves more than maintaining the roof or keeping the landscaping tidy. One of the biggest threats to a property’s structure often goes unnoticed until significant damage has already occurred. Termites can quietly feed on wooden components for months, sometimes years, before homeowners discover they’re there. That’s why prevention and early detection are essential for preserving both your home’s safety and value.

4. Preventive Maintenance Strengthens Your Home
Professional termite pest control doesn’t stop after treatment. Long-term protection often includes recommendations that make your home less attractive to termites.
Simple improvements can have a meaningful impact, such as:
- Repairing plumbing leaks quickly
- Improving drainage around the foundation
- Keeping mulch and soil away from wooden siding
- Storing firewood away from exterior walls
- Reducing excess moisture in crawl spaces
When combined with routine inspections, these maintenance habits help create a stronger defense against termite activity.
